Summary

The Evolution of Love by Emil Lucka is a philosophical and cultural-historical exploration of how the concept of love has developed across human history.

Rather than treating love merely as a biological instinct or a literary trope, Lucka presents love as a social, emotional, and intellectual phenomenon that evolved through different eras and civilizations.

He traces love from primitive erotic impulses, through the spiritualization of love in medieval courtly traditions, to modern romantic ideals.

The book examines how love became linked to individualism, personal freedom, and emotional expression, shaped by religion, art, and philosophy.

Lucka discusses key moments and figures—drawing from mythology, classical antiquity, the Middle Ages, and the Renaissance—showing how love transitioned from a reproductive function to a complex emotional and cultural force.
